使用距离查找器创建谷歌搜索API

时间:2015-09-04 11:56:35

标签: javascript html5 google-maps google-maps-api-3

我正在创建一个网站,我希望在附近按地点搜索,查找距离并根据距离显示地点来实施google-map API。

现在我只是创建了一张地图并使用了Google地方搜索API。 我为link here

所做的工作

我只是想创建一个类似于page

的地图

1 个答案:

答案 0 :(得分:2)

对于距离,我使用Google Geocoder API进行了我的项目。

这是我制作的Gist,你可以用你正在使用的任何语言翻译它。基本上,请调用此URL:

" https://maps.googleapis.com/maps/api/geocode/json?address=[YOUR_ADDRESS_STRING]"

API将返回一堆信息。最重要的是纬度和经度。比,您可以使用Haversine Formula中的那些。该公式需要两个点(它们的纬度和经度)并计算这些点之间的距离。

点击此处了解详情:https://developers.google.com/maps/documentation/geocoding/intro

我没有实现地图标记或其他任何东西,但我希望这可以帮助你了解距离。